summaryrefslogtreecommitdiffstats
path: root/drivers/usb/dwc2/hcd_ddma.c
diff options
context:
space:
mode:
authorMitch Williams2015-06-23 02:26:38 +0200
committerJeff Kirsher2015-06-26 11:52:27 +0200
commit40746eb14c6b44f4d635c2f4cf8c67550db9b3ab (patch)
tree450f0c24178c50fc18cb728575daa620dd61dfc6 /drivers/usb/dwc2/hcd_ddma.c
parenti40evf: fix panic during MTU change (diff)
downloadkernel-qcow2-linux-40746eb14c6b44f4d635c2f4cf8c67550db9b3ab.tar.gz
kernel-qcow2-linux-40746eb14c6b44f4d635c2f4cf8c67550db9b3ab.tar.xz
kernel-qcow2-linux-40746eb14c6b44f4d635c2f4cf8c67550db9b3ab.zip
i40evf: don't configure unused RSS queues
The driver will only configure as many queues as there are available CPUs, up the maximum number of queues. However, it always configures RSS as though it is using the maximum number of queues. This can cause the device to drop a lot of RX traffic, as the packets get assigned to nonfunctional queues. Fix this by only configuring RSS with the number of active queues. Signed-off-by: Mitch Williams <mitch.a.williams@intel.com> Signed-off-by: Jeff Kirsher <jeffrey.t.kirsher@intel.com>
Diffstat (limited to 'drivers/usb/dwc2/hcd_ddma.c')
0 files changed, 0 insertions, 0 deletions